BEWARE of Tools -

Not all Free tools are created equally. Some are outright dangerous!

I've been studying ALOT so I can share info with you. One of the best free tools there is - is Google itself. There is so much information there. And much info about what NOT to do.
They say it isn't necessary, or even wise, to pay a company to get you front page listings on search engines, nor is it wise to have services submitting to directories, etc. for you. Actually, that is the WRONG way to promote. The smartest way to promote your site is just to make it content rich and get it to people who want the info. Exchanging links with similar companies is good. Newsletters are good. The NORMAL ways....which may be slower, but will be much more productive long term.

Some of the free tools I have shared with you ARE very good. Banner exchanges are good, in my opinion, because people only view your page if they're actually interested in your banner.
I understand that banners are making a come-back now. Probably for this very reason,,,people are learning that shortcuts aren't really shortcuts. They can actually be detrimental to your online business health!
